FORT GREENE — A registered sex offender was caught stealing a stove from a Fort Greene home in broad daylight late last month, according to police.

The owner of the building saw Jorge Martinez, 59, wheeling a stove out of his Vanderbilt Avenue building with a hand truck around 1 p.m. on Dec. 29, police said.

The owner then called police who arrested Martinez on charges of burglary and trespassing, the NYPD said.

Martinez was also arrested last year for sexually abusing two minors under 10 years old over a period of several years.

He pleaded guilty to the sex offense on Aug. 18 and was sentenced to a year in prison. It is unclear how many months he spent in jail before he was arrested again in December.

Martinez pleaded guilty to misdemeanor criminal trespass charges on Jan. 6. He was fined $250 and sentenced to time served.

The Brooklyn DA did not comment on why the other charges were dropped and the building owner and Martinez's lawyer could not be reached for comment.

In other crime in the 88th Precinct:

• A gunman stole $700 from Fulton Street Bagels on Dec. 31, police said. The robber entered the store, at 558 Fulton St., around 3 p.m. and picked up two cans of soda, the NYPD said.

He then brought the cans to the register, showed the cashier a gun and said, “Don’t move. Give me all the money," according to police.

The cashier gave him cash and the thief ran down Fulton Street leaving the soda behind, police said. The NYPD is checking the cans for fingerprints and an investigation is ongoing, police said.

• A Fort Greene bar was burglarized on Dec. 29, police said. The burglar, who entered the Dekalb Avenue bar through a side window, stole bottles of Hendrick’s Gin and Grey Goose Vodka as well as $96 in cash, according to police. No arrests were made. The exact address of the bar was not available.
